Christopher Street Liberation Day March, 1973
Members of S.T.A.R. (Street Transvestite Action Revolutionaries) at the fourth annual Christopher Street Liberation Day March, 1973. Sylvia Rivera founded S.T.A.R. in 1969 with Marsha P. Johnson as a splinter group from the Gay Liberation Front, to focus on supporting New York’s trans community and providing shelter for trans homeless youth. Photograph from the Rudy Grillo Collection, the LGBT Community Center National History Archives.
